ALLEVA DAIRY
188 Grand St at Mulberry St. Subway J, Z, #6 to Canal St. Mon-Sat 8.30am-6pm, Sun
8.30am-3pm. MAP
The oldest Italian formaggiaio (cheesemonger) and grocery in America (1892). Makes
its own smoked mozzarella, provolone and ricotta.
DI PALO'S FINE FOODS
200 Grand St at Mott St. Subway B, D to Grand St. Mon-Sat
9am-6.30pm, Sun 9am-4pm. MAP
Charming and authoritative family-run business, open
since 1925, that sells some of the city's best ricotta,
along with a fine selection of aged balsamic vinegars,
oils and home-made pastas.
INA
21 Prince St between Elizabeth and Mott sts. Subway R, N to Prince St. Mon-Sat noon-8pm, Sun
noon-7pm. MAP
Favourite consignment shop selling recent season cast-offs. Full of bargains; there's a
men's branch at 19 Prince St (next door; same hours).
MCNALLY JACKSON
52 Prince St, between Mulberry and Lafayette sts. Subway N, R to Prince St. Mon-Sat 10am-10pm, Sun
10am-9pm. MAP
This independent Canadian book chain has a great café and excellent literary events.
ME & RO
241 Elizabeth St between Houston and Prince sts. Subway B, D, F, M to Broadway-Lafayette; R, N to
Prince St. Mon-Sat 11am-7pm, Sun noon-6pm. MAP
The hottest, most distinctive jewellery designer in Manhattan, with tasteful Modernist
designs inspired by the traditions of China, India and Tibet.
